Diversity Equity Inclusion & Belonging

At Clean & Tidy Home Show, we are committed to creating an inclusive and welcoming environment for all our community. As an exhibitor, your support in upholding these values is crucial. Below are guidelines and best practices to help you integrate DEIB principles into your participation:

1. Diverse Representation

Staffing: Ensure your booth staff reflects diverse backgrounds, including gender, race, ethnicity, age, ability, and other dimensions of diversity.

Content: Highlight a diverse range of voices in your promotional materials, presentations, and product demonstrations.

2. Accessibility

Stand Design: Design your stand to be accessible to people with disabilities. This includes providing ramps, wide aisles, and seating options.

Materials: Offer materials in various formats, such as large print, braille, and digital versions compatible with screen readers.

Communication: Train your staff on how to interact respectfully and effectively with attendees with disabilities.

3. Inclusive Language and Imagery

Language: Use inclusive and non-discriminatory language in all communications. Avoid jargon that may exclude or alienate certain groups.

Imagery: Use diverse and inclusive images in your stand displays, brochures, and other marketing materials.
